History of Pioli Family Endowment:
Women Leaders in Sports and NFL Executive Scott Pioli announced the "Pioli Family Endowed HBCU Scholarship" in 2019, which marked the organization's first endowment and came at a historical milestone for the organization as Women Leaders celebrated its 40th Anniversary. Scott Pioli has been a dear friend and male champion of the Women Leaders organization for many years and has served as a lifelong mentor and supporter of women working in sports. He began personally investing in Women Leaders in 2018, personally funding a Convention attendance scholarship for an HBCU woman leader before endowing the fund in 2018. The Pioli Family Endowed HBCU Scholarship ensures long-term sustainability for membership scholarship that directly supports women in our organization from HBCUs.
In the words of Scott:
"We have been connected with our good friend Patti Phillips and the organizational leadership team of Women Leaders in Sports for years. I've worked alongside them as they have invested in, mentored, and prepared so many qualified women for leadership opportunities," said Scott Pioli. "We are hopeful this endowment will help encourage and propel women from historically black colleges and universities (HBCU) to influential roles within the industry of college sports and beyond."
"Our family considers it an honor and a privilege to endow this fund and to continue our partnership with Women Leaders in College Sports," said Dallas Pioli, wife of Scott Pioli.
